Output 29428d0aa154c4702d9eab9c9e9213a3ed573594ce3116e695b7cbecda213948:0

value
652613
script pubkey
OP_0 OP_PUSHBYTES_20 105eca7ef6827d59926d67fe4be89da919bdffbe
address
bc1qzp0v5lhksf74nyndvllyh6ya4yvmmla7ercdh5
transaction
29428d0aa154c4702d9eab9c9e9213a3ed573594ce3116e695b7cbecda213948
confirmations
56247
spent
true